Possibly an 'end of day' studio pottery piece. Nicely worked, but can't seem to identify the impressed mark. Initially thought it could be Alan Brough, but sadly, it isn't. Anyone help? Thanks.

I've seen a number of pots and a few hedgehogs with this AB mark but not managed to ID it. The shape of the hedgehog is similar to this one by Mickleton Pottery but different clay. Mickleton Pottery was run by Alistair Brookes so chances are the AB is for him, but I cant prove it at the moment
